Ryk E. Spoor

Ryk E. Spoor

Born in Omaha, Nebraska, Ryk E. Spoor and his family moved around the country quite a bit before settling in upstate New York. A long-time fan of SF, fantasy, and roleplaying games, Ryk Spoor became a playtesting consultant and writer for the Wizards of the Coast, the leading publisher of role-playing games and related novels while earning his masters degree in Pittsburgh. He now lives in Troy, NY, working as a technical proposal writer for a high-tech R&D firm, and spending his non-writer time with his wife, two sons, two daughters, and a small poodle. Mr. Spoor is the coauthor, with New York Times best seller Eric Flint, of the popular Boundary series of hard science fiction novels and Castaway Planet, a YA SF novel set in the same universe. Spoor's solo novels for Baen include urban fantasy Paradigms Lost, epic-scale space opera Grand Central Arena and its sequel Spheres of Influence, and the epic fantasy trilogy The Balanced Sword, which includes Phoenix Rising, Phoenix in Shadow, and now Phoenix Ascendant. In addition, he self-published his Oz-based novel Polychrome in 2015 after a very successful Kickstarter campaign. Future projects include another Arenaverse sequel, Challenges of the Deeps, a sequel to Castaway Planet titled Castaway Odyssey, and a new unique fantasy in the magical girl genre, Princess Holy Aura.
